POSITION ANNOUNCEMENT

Adjunct Instructor – Communication Mount Vernon Nazarene University exists to shape lives through educating the whole person and cultivating Christ-likeness for lifelong learning and service. Mount Vernon Nazarene University (MVNU) is an intentionally Christian teaching university for traditional age students, graduate students, and working adults who seek opportunities to learn and grow in an academic community of faith. The University provides the context for a transformational experience through excellent academics, service opportunities, caring relationships, and a nurturing spiritual and social environment. Faculty, staff, and students are challenged to achieve their highest potential, to become increasingly Christ-like and to make a difference in their world through lifelong service. The University seeks part-time Adjunct Instructors to teach Public Speaking and/or Interpersonal Communication in the Communication Department on the Mount Vernon main campus. Both are options for MVNU’s general education Communication Arts credit and required in the Communication and Media major, plus certain minors and concentrations.

Responsibilities for this position include:

∙Teach one spring section of COM1023 Public Speaking as needed ∙Teach 1-2 sections each semester (fall/spring) of COM1013 Interpersonal Communication as needed ∙Adequately prepare all course materials and lessons ∙Provide each student with clear course expectations, evaluations and timelines through carefully written topical outlines and approved, standardized syllabus ∙Provide interesting and relevant assignments for students that demonstrate learning outcomes in a real-life setting ∙Suitably challenge, engage, serve and communicate with students to encourage their participation and learning while maintaining mutual value and respect ∙Complete grade books, final grade sheets, learning assessments and final exam assessments in a timely manner ∙Respond to student questions in a timely manner ∙Identify and refer at-risk students to specific academic support services ∙Ensure course and program learning outcomes are delivered as defined by the syllabus

Minimum Qualifications:

∙Master’s degree in speech, communication, rhetoric, or a related field preferred and/or ∙Five years professional experience and expertise in the field of speech communication Expectations for the successful candidate: ∙Evangelical Christian confession of faith and experience (Statement of Faith required at application) ∙Expertise in interpersonal and oral presentation/written communication skills ∙Engaging classroom style and appreciation of successful instructional approaches for a range of academic abilities Interested candidates should send a curriculum vita, names of three references with contact information, a one to two-page statement of educational philosophy, a one to two-page statement of faith, and copies of university transcripts electronically to: Joe Rinehart Chair, Communication Department Mount Vernon Nazarene University 800 Martinsburg Road Mount Vernon, Ohio 43050 jrinehar@mvnu.edu Mount Vernon Nazarene University does not unlawfully discriminate on the basis of race, color, sex, national origin, age, disability, or military service in administering its employment policies and practices.
